Haruna Iddrisu Finally Speaks on Ayariga’s Bribery Allegation

Minority Leader, Haruna Iddrisu, has promised to submit himself to full investigations in the infamous bribery scandal that has rocked the appointment committee.

The Minority Leader made this known during the vetting of Hon. Akoto Osei, Minister-designate for Monitoring evaluation today.

He said: “I will support the full investigation to establish the veracity or otherwise any matter that bothers on parliament. I expect the speaker and the leadership of parliament to take up the matter and conduct full investigations”.

Bawku Central Member of Parliament is alleging that the Minister of Energy through the appointments Committee chairman tried bribing members with three thousand cedis each to approve his vetting.

The Member of Parliament with the support of two other Minority MPs, Alhassan Suhuyini and Samuel Okudzeto Ablakwa have subsequently petitioned the Speaker of Parliament to thoroughly look into the matter.
